To reduce the injurious effect of oxidative stress, cells are equipped with two major antioxidant defense systems. The first concerns numerous enzymes, which catalyze ROS degradation, such as superoxide dismutase (SOD), catalase or glutathione peroxidase (GPx) ... [Pg.167]

Devasena and Menon (2007) reported that fenugreek seeds had a modulatory effect on colon tumour incidence, as well as hepatic lipid peroxidation (LPO) during DMH (1,2-dimethylhydrazine) colon carcinogenesis in male Wistar rats. In DMH-treated rats, 100% colon tumour incidence was accompanied by enhanced LPO and a decrease in reduced glutathione (GSH) content, as well as a fall in glutathione peroxidase (GPx), glutathione S-transferase (GST), superoxide dismutase (SOD) and catalase (CAT) activities. Inclusion of fenugreek seed powder in the diet of DMH-treated rats reduced the colon tumour incidence to 16.6%, decreased the lipid peroxidation and increased the activities of GPx, GST, SOD and CAT in the liver. [Pg.252]

Selenium is an essential trace element, being important in at least two critical enzymes, the antioxidant glutathione peroxidase (GPx), and type 1 iodothyronine deiodinase. GPx converts hydrogen peroxide to water, in the presence of reduced glutathione, while iodothyronine deiodinase catalyzes the conversion of thyroxine to triiodothyronine, the physiologically active hormone species. [Pg.23]
